Introduction: The Flow Swim Chamois - Your Post-Swim Solution

For swimmers, divers, triathletes, and anyone participating in water sports, having a reliable, quick-drying towel is essential. The Flow Swim Chamois, from Flow Swim Gear, aims to provide just that. This lightweight, compact towel is designed for superior absorbency and rapid drying, making it a convenient option for both travel and everyday use. Unlike bulky beach towels, the chamois is easily packable, making it ideal for athletes on the go. This review will delve into its performance, examining its features, advantages, and potential drawbacks to help you decide if it's the right towel for your needs.

The Flow Swim Chamois is marketed as a superior alternative to traditional cotton towels, promising to dry significantly faster and be more compact for easy portability. This makes it attractive to individuals who value efficiency and convenience, particularly those involved in competitive swimming or triathlons where quick transitions are critical. Its lightweight design is another key selling point, appealing to athletes who prioritize minimizing extra weight during training or competitions.

Pros: What Makes the Flow Swim Chamois Stand Out

  • Exceptional Absorbency: The Flow Swim Chamois effectively absorbs water, leaving you feeling dry quickly after your swim or water activity. Its microfiber material is designed to wick away moisture effectively.
  • Rapid Drying Time: Compared to traditional cotton towels, the Flow Swim Chamois dries significantly faster, reducing the inconvenience of carrying a damp towel.
  • Lightweight and Compact: Its small size and lightweight design make it incredibly convenient for travel and easy to pack in a swim bag or gym bag. It doesn't take up valuable space.

Cons: Areas for Improvement

  • Durability Concerns: Some users report that after repeated use and washing, the towel shows signs of wear and tear more quickly than other options. The long-term durability may be a concern for some individuals.
  • Initial Feel: Some may find the initial feel of the microfiber to be slightly different from a traditional cotton towel. While many appreciate the smooth texture, others may prefer a softer, fluffier feel.
